This luxury Emilia glasshouse can be used for so much more than just gardening - a reading room, a workshop, a studio, a socialising space... the list goes on.
Designed primarily as a greenhouse, but add an appropriate polyurethane or silicone sealant to the panels to create a watertight space to enjoy. With a floor space of 8,2m², you will be able to fit an outdoor dining set or lounge set and still have space for your plants around it, creating a beautiful green oasis.
The single glaze 4mm glass is toughened for extra security and the roof features a bi-thermal opener which automatically opens the roof vents for ventilation when the glasshouse becomes too hot. The Emilia has all the bells & whistles to get growing if you choose to use it as a traditional greenhouse & your veggies will be flourishing in no time.
The glasshouse's grey-wash Nordic Spruce frame comes pressure-treated for longevity with impra®lit-KDS - a water-borne, chromium free wood preservative (copper-organics) for the prevention of attack by insects including termites, soft rot and fungal decay.
As the night draws in you’ll be able to pop down to your glasshouse to stargaze, protected from chill and draughts. The pitched roof of the Emilia gives the structure a traditional feel, whilst its glazed, real glass panels make it sleek & modern.
With comprehensive instructions, assembly is easier than you might expect. It's time to finally do-up that neglected spot in the garden, transforming it into an attractive multi-use space with the Emilia Glasshouse.

SPECIFICATIONS:
Footprint: 240cm x 363cm
Wall Thickness: 18mm
Glass thickness: 4mm
Overall Height: 283cm
Wall Height: 159cm
1 x (Single) Door
2 x Automated Opening Roof Vents
Floor Area: 8.2m²
Roof Area: 12.5m²
Gross Ground Area: 5.8m²
Roof Gradient: 45°
Wood: impra®lit-KDS pressure treated Grey-Wash Nordic Spruce, treated according to European Standard EN351-1
Glass: 4mm single glazed toughened glass
Carton size: 3.8m x 1.2m x 0.4m
Carton weight: 600kg
This glass house has a floor area under 30m², this means it is exempt from the consent process when added to your property as a structure for ancillary use. Please see our 'consent information' button below for more information.
Note: For improved watertightness, add a sealant such as 3M™ Marine Adhesive Sealant 5200, or Dow Dowsil™ 739 Plastic Bonding Silicone Adhesive
This Glasshouse is fantastic and very stylish. It was easy and quick to construct, and we have very happy clients. Care with your foundation should result in a very long-standing productive glasshouse. There is just the one fault in that the door swings back with the handle touching the window. There is potential for the door handle to smash this window if it is caught by the wind. We have fixed this by using a self-latching door stop so when the door is opened it latches back. All in all, an excellent product

I was really impressed with the quality and accuracy of the component parts. Though there were no written instructions the drawings were, as they say, worth a thousand words: fine lines and accuracy made following the order of construction easy. I found by adapting the order a little, particularly in installing the roof glass, made construction without the help of a second person easy. The packaging was minimal but obviously adequate. This is a beautiful greenhouse which anyone with a bit of DIY experience can construct. I recommend it very highly.
